安装SQLTools插件并通过Package Control搜索安装;2. 根据数据库类型安装对应命令行工具并配置PATH;3. 在用户设置中添加MySQL、PostgreSQL等连接信息;4. 创建.sql文件,右键选择连接并执行查询,结果在输出面板显示;5. 可自定义快捷键并配合其他插件实现语法高亮与自动补全,支持多连接切换,提升轻量级数据库操作效率。

Sublime Text 本身是一个轻量级代码编辑器,不具备直接连接数据库执行 SQL 的功能。但通过安装和配置 SQLTools 插件,可以实现数据库连接、SQL 编辑高亮、语法提示以及执行查询等操作。
1. 安装 SQLTools 插件
确保你已安装 Package Control(Sublime 的插件管理工具),然后按以下步骤操作:
- 按下 Ctrl+Shift+P(Windows/Linux)或 Cmd+Shift+P(Mac)打开命令面板
- 输入 Install Package 并选择对应选项
- 搜索 SQLTools,点击安装
2. 安装数据库驱动程序
SQLTools 依赖外部命令行工具与数据库通信。你需要根据使用的数据库安装对应的客户端工具:
-
MySQL:安装
mysql命令行客户端(通常包含在 MySQL Server 或 MySQL Client 安装包中) -
PostgreSQL:安装
psql -
SQLite:安装
sqlite3 -
SQL Server:安装
sqlcmd或msql
确保这些命令能在系统终端中直接运行(即已加入系统 PATH)。
3. 配置数据库连接
安装完成后,按下 Ctrl+Shift+P,输入 SQLTools: Settings 打开用户配置文件。
在右侧的用户设置中添加你的数据库连接信息,例如 MySQL 示例:
{
"connections": {
"my_mysql_db": {
"type": "mysql",
"host": "localhost",
"port": 3306,
"user": "root",
"password": "your_password",
"database": "test_db"
},
"my_postgres": {
"type": "postgres",
"host": "localhost",
"port": 5432,
"user": "postgres",
"password": "123456",
"database": "demo"
}
}
}
支持的 type 类型包括:mysql、postgres、sqlite、mssql 等。
4. 使用 SQLTools 执行 SQL
- 新建一个文件,保存为
.sql后缀(如query.sql) - 右键选择 SQLTools: Select Connection,选择你配置的连接(如
my_mysql_db) - 编写 SQL 语句,例如:
SELECT * FROM users LIMIT 10; - 选中要执行的 SQL 语句,右键选择 SQLTools: Execute Query
- 查询结果将在 Sublime 的输出面板中显示
5. 快捷键与功能增强
- 可自定义快捷键执行查询(默认无绑定,可在 Preferences → Key Bindings 中设置)
- 支持语法高亮、自动补全(需配合其他插件如 SQLComplete)
- 支持多连接切换,适合同时操作多个数据库
基本上就这些。SQLTools 让 Sublime Text 拥有了基础的数据库操作能力,虽然不如专业 IDE 强大,但对于轻量开发或快速查询非常实用。










